Climate and Weather

Luxor and Aswan are located in the southern part of Egypt, in the region known as Upper Egypt. The climate in this region is hot and dry, with very little rainfall throughout the year. The temperature varies greatly between summer and winter, with summer being the hottest season and winter being the coolest. Understanding the climate and weather patterns is essential to plan your trip and make the most of your time in Luxor and Aswan.
